Nunavut, a territory in Canada, covers an area of approximately 2 million square kilometers (around 770,000 square miles), making it the largest and northernmost territory in the country. It comprises a vast expanse of Arctic land, including numerous islands and a portion of the mainland. Nunavut's size accounts for about one-fifth of Canada's total land area. The territory is characterized by its remote landscapes, low population density, and unique Indigenous culture.
